The new allotments are in Station Road behind the existing Allotments. The land is owned by the National Trust who lease the land to the Parish Council. the plots are are overseen by an 'Allotment Association' who are responsible for allocating plots and collecting the rent. There are 48 plots in total including 12 half plots. A full plot measures 6mx27m, half plot 6m x 13.5m. |
Costs:
£20 per year for full sized plot
£10 per year for a half plot.
Public Liability Insurance. It is a requirement by the Parish Council for each plot holder to have £5million cover., the allotment association have organized this at a cost of £3 per year. In addition to the insurance cover, plot holders are entitled to take part in a seed scheme where they can buy seeds and other goods a large discount.
Rent Due Date.
Rents are paid in advance and due on 1st March. each year.
Note: The rent due date has changed, this was decided at the EGM 26th July 2012, plot holders also voted to pay 18months rent in Sept 2012, so that the next rent due date would be on March 2013. This applies to all new plot holders.
New tenancies
A joining fee of £30 per plot is payable with the first rental payment. This is returnable at the end of the tenancy less any costs incurred by the association to return your plot to a good condition.
Waiting List Policy change - Monday 9th April 2012
This policy applies to all everyone requesting an allotment from 9/4/2012.
People who live in the Parish of Broadclyst will be given priority over any one else on the waiting list.
People outside the parish should be considered if there is no one else within the parish on the waiting list.
If a person already has an allotment with the BAA and wish to take one another plot this will only be considered if there is no one on the waiting list.
*Amendment 6th June 2013.
If a plot becomes available adjacent to an existing plot holder who has requested a second then this vacant may be offered to them regardless of the waiting list.
